GEORGE E. MYERS SCHOLARSHIP

Picture

HISTORY


The Defense Credit Union Council established the George E. Myers Scholarship Fund in 1996 in honor of COL George E. Myers, USA (Ret.). Colonel Myers was an Executive Secretary of the Council and selected to the first DCUC Hall of Honor.

​Since 1997, DCUC has awarded 73 scholarships totaling over $218,000.

PURPOSE & ELIGIBILITY


The Fund’s purpose is to provide scholarships for volunteers, management, and/or staff of DCUC member credit unions so they can further their professional credit union education, knowledge and leadership skills.
